Objective

Determine whether the cluster target option works as designed for the MIPS Ph/SR and SED AOTs.

Description

Take a series of observations which exercise the various parameters of the cluster option.

Data Collected

This task is implemented by commanding the following AORs: 1) 24 µm photometry of Nu Dor: offset cluster with 3 positions 2) 24 µm photometry of Nu Dor; position cluster with 3 positions 3) 24 µm photometry of Asteroid Lick; moving cluster with 3 positions 4) 24 µm photometry of Nu Dor; offset cluster with 2 positions, offsets only 5) SED of Asteroid Lick; moving cluster with 1 position 6) SED of NGC 2346; position cluster with 3 positions Currently, this set of AORs is missing SED offset cluster due to lack of time.
